Malawi prison band nominated for Grammy Awards

The month of February may be a month of global recognition and acclaim for a Malawi prison band surprisingly nominated for the prestigious Grammy Awards set to be staged next month.

Popularly known as the Zomba Prison Project band, the ensemble comprises convicted murderer Elias Chimenya, on bass guitar, burgler Stefano Nyerenda, and prison guard Thomas Binamo is one of the bands songwriters.

The musical talent of the trio was discovered in 2013 when US producer, Ian Brennan spent two weeks working with 60 inmates on a 20 track album titled ‘I Have No Everything Here’ which got nominated in the Best World Music category of the awards gala ceremony set to be staged in the city of Los Angeles, U.S.A.
